About DigiByte

DigiByte (DGB) is an open-source blockchain and asset creation platform. Its development started in October 2013, and its genesis block was mined in January 2014 as a fork of Bitcoin (BTC).

About MovieBloc

MovieBloc is a decentralized movie and content distribution platform. MBL is used for economic activity in the ecosystem, such as watching premium content, creators paying translators, donating to other participants, and rewarding the users.
